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Outlying South Allegheny
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Outlying South Allegheny?
Actualmente hay 3222 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Outlying South Allegheny, PA con precios que van desde $308 hasta $12,802. También hay 712 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Outlying South Allegheny que van desde $250 hasta $8,950.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Outlying South Allegheny?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Outlying South Allegheny oscilan entre $250 hasta $8,950 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,281.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Outlying South Allegheny?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Outlying South Allegheny oscilan entre $620 hasta $7,357,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$500 hasta $8,950.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$600 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,195.
